Mitch Marner scored the only goal of the shootout as the Toronto Maple Leafs fought back from 2-0 and 5-3 deficits to defeat the Montreal Canadiens 6-5 in a wild NHL regular-season opener for both teams Wednesday.

The Maple Leafs star scored a second period power-play goal against the Montreal Canadiens in Wednesday’s home opener to become the fastest player in franchise history to reach the 300-goal mark.

Believe your ears: After five full seasons of blasting Hall & Oates’ happy-go-lucky ’80s pop jam “You Make My Dreams (Come True),” the Leafs unveiled a brand-new goal song during Wednesday’s home opener at Scotiabank Arena.
